Background technology
Powdery paints is the form entirely different with general coating, it is existing for state with attritive powder.Due to not
Using solvent, so referred to as powdery paints.The main feature of powdery paints has:With harmless, high efficiency, save resource and environmental protection
Feature.What is be most widely used in powdery paints is polyester powder coating, polyester powder coating and other types of powders coating phases
Than, it is with unique properties, show that weatherability, resistance to ultraviolet rotary light performance are better than epoxy resin.It is carried additionally, due to polyester resin
Polar group is not easy yellowing so powder utilization is higher than epoxy resin in baking process, glossiness is high, good leveling property, and paint film is rich
It is full, the characteristics such as of light color, thus with decorative well.
It when manufacturing polyester powder coating, needs various dusty raw materials being put into powder agitator and is stirred, make
Various raw materials are uniformly mixed, because need to use the lipid materials such as polyester resin and epoxy resin when making polyester powder coating, are gathered
The particle of ester resin and epoxy resin is larger or polyester resin and epoxy resin during preservation since the holding time is long or
Excessively high etc. reasons of Conservation environment temperature cause polyester resin and epoxy resin caking etc., can cause all kinds of raw materials in whipping process
It stirs uneven.
Utility model content
In view of the deficienciess of the prior art, the purpose of this utility model is to provide a kind of stirrings of powdery paints to crush
Bucket, can crush the raw material that need to be stirred in whipping process, make stirring evenly.
To achieve the above object, the utility model provides following technical solution:A kind of powdery paints stirring grinding barrel, packet
Holder, the agitator on holder are included, stirring bottom of the barrel is passed vertically through and one end is located at agitating shaft in agitator, positioned at stirring
It mixes the blade on axis and is connected to the stirring motor that power is provided far from agitator one end for agitating shaft on agitating shaft, the stirring
It is provided with feed inlet and discharge nozzle on bucket, feed cap is provided on the feed inlet, outlet valve is provided on the discharge nozzle, also
Including the grinding device being arranged in agitator, the grinding device includes being stirred across the shaft of agitator side wall and setting
It is crushing motor that shaft provides power that bucket is outer to be connected with shaft, and the shaft, which is located on the one end of agitator inside, to be uniformly arranged
There is flabellum.
By using above-mentioned technical proposal, the switch of stirring motor is opened, then opens feed cap, powdery paints is poured into and is stirred
It mixes in bucket, when powdery paints is finished down, closes feed cap, open and crush motor, crush motor and shaft rotation, shaft is driven to drive position
In the flabellum rotation in agitator, flabellum can crush coating powder, can make particle is larger in powdery paints powder or
The powder of caking crushes, and makes to stir evenly.
The utility model is further arranged to:The flabellum is trapezoidal.
By using above-mentioned technical proposal, the flabellum of trapezoidal design forms wind-force, relatively narrow one end can be right in rotation process
Powdery paints is adequately crushed, and being crushed sufficient powdery paints can be uniformly mixed.
The utility model is further arranged to:The side setting of the flabellum is fluted.
By using above-mentioned technical proposal, when flabellum when rotated, powdery paints can enter groove, then by going out in groove
Come, contact of the powdery paints with flabellum can be increased, powdery paints is formed broken.
The utility model is further arranged to:The grinding device has 4 and is uniformly arranged on one week of agitator.
By using above-mentioned technical proposal, one week in agitator is arranged in breaker, it can be to the powder in agitator
Coating is adequately crushed, and avoids causing breaker setting at one broken insufficient.
The utility model is further arranged to:The annulus being fixedly connected on the flabellum is provided on the flabellum.
By using above-mentioned technical proposal, for flabellum in rotary course, the one end being fixed in shaft is relatively stable, is used for
In rotary course, unfixed support can cause flabellum unstable, annulus is arranged on flabellum, can make for broken one end
The even flabellum being arranged in shaft is unified to be fixed, and flabellum when rotated, also can be relatively stable.
The utility model is further arranged to:The agitating shaft is located at one end in agitator in cone.
It, will not heap on conical agitating shaft when powdery paints is poured into agitator by using above-mentioned technical proposal
Product coating powder, in agitating shaft rotary course, powdery paints will not be packed together, and make stirring evenly.
The utility model is further arranged to:The conical agitating shaft top in agitator is provided with cross bar.
By using above-mentioned technical proposal, when opening agitating shaft, when agitating shaft starts rotation, cross bar also begins to rotate,
The powdery paints poured into is disperseed around by the cross bar rotated, and the cross bar on conical agitating shaft, which is arranged, can make powdery paints side
Stirring side disperses into agitator, evenly convenient for stirring.
The utility model is further arranged to:The shaft and the junction of agitator inner wall are provided with sealing ring.
By using above-mentioned technical proposal, sealing ring is arranged in shaft and the junction of agitator inner wall, powder can be prevented to apply
Material leaks out in whipping process from the junction of shaft and agitator inner wall.
The utility model is further arranged to:It is provided with handle on the feed cap.
By using above-mentioned technical proposal, when needing to open feed cap, handrail only need to be held, lifts feed cap,
Handle is set on feed cap, can be convenient for opening feed cap.
The utility model is further arranged to:The handwheel for fixing the feed cap is provided on the agitator.
By using above-mentioned technical proposal, handwheel is tightened, the bottom surface of handwheel is contacted with feed cap, when continuing to tighten handwheel
When, so that feed cap is in close contact with agitator, covers tightly feed cap.
In conclusion the utility model has the advantages that:The utility model on agitator side wall by being arranged
Breaker, the broken motor in breaker drive shaft rotation, and the flabellum rotation in shaft can break powdery paints
It is broken, so that powdery paints is stirred evenly;Flabellum is designed to trapezoidal, and groove is set in trapezoidal flabellum side, powder can be made to apply
Expect to increase the time contacted with flabellum in whipping process, make broken abundant;Agitating shaft is located at the design of one end in agitator
It is conical, it can prevent when pouring into powdery paints in agitator, powdery paints is fallen on agitating shaft, and collection of drama is in agitating shaft
On;Cross bar is set on conical agitating shaft, powdery paints can be made when pouring into agitator, is distributed to surrounding in agitator,
It is not gathered at one.
